Microsatellite-based parentage analysis of factorial crosses in Pacific oyster (Crassostrea gigas) larvae and spat ArchiMer
Taris, Nicolas; Sauvage, Christopher; Ernande, Bruno; Boudry, Pierre.
Several studies have suggested that significant genetic variability might exist for some early developmental traits in the Pacific oyster, C. gigas. However, most studies have examined only limited numbers of families. More critically, these families were rarely replicated, leading to possible bias due to heterogeneous larval rearing conditions among families. To overcome these potential problems, we used a mixed-family approach with subsequent parentage analysis. A recently developed set of three multiplexed microsatellite markers was used to determine parentage in a complete factorial cross between 12 males and 4 females. Larvae were reared at two different temperatures (20 and 26°C) to provide a contrast resembling wild versus hatchery conditions....

Genetic variation for growth at one and two summers of age in the common carp (Cyprinus carpio L.): Heritability estimates and response to selection ArchiMer
Vandeputte, Marc; Kocour, M; Mauger, S; Rodina, M; Launay, A; Gela, D; Dupont Nivet, M; Hulak, M; Linhart, O.
We estimated the heritability of growth-related traits (weight and length at ages one summer, first spring and two summers) in a synthetic mirror carp strain (HSM) in the Czech Republic. The four generation pedigree was obtained from parentage assignment of three factorial mating designs with microsatellite markers, and included 195 fish without phenotypes (48 G0, 147 G1) and 1321 fish with phenotypes (674 G2, 647 G3). Animal model heritability estimates over generations were in the range 0.21-0.33 for length and in the range 0.31-0.44 for weight. The genetic correlation between length and weight was high (0.97). The correlations between growth measurements in the first and in the second summer of age were moderate to low (0.34-0.67). Divergent selection...

Genetic improvement for disease resistance in oysters: a review ArchiMer
Degremont, Lionel; Garcia, Celine; Allen, Standish K., Jr..
Oyster species suffer from numerous disease outbreaks, often causing high mortality. Because the environment cannot be controlled, genetic improvement for disease resistance to pathogens is an attractive option to reduce their impact on oyster production. We review the literature on selective breeding programs for disease resistance in oyster species, and the impact of triploidy on such resistance. Significant response to selection to improve disease resistance was observed in all studies after two to four generations of selection for Haplosporidium nelsoni and Roseovarius crassostrea in Crassostrea virginica, OsHV-1 in Crassostrea gigas, and Martelia sydneyi in Saccostrea glomerata. Clearly, resistance in these cases was heritable, but most of the studies...

Response to divergent selection for resistance to summer mortality in Pacific oyster spat : genetic parameters and correlated responses with subsequent survival and growth ArchiMer
Boudry, Pierre; Bedier, Edouard; Ernande, Bruno; Degremont, Lionel.
The multidisciplinary program "MOREST" aims to improve our understanding of causes of summer mortality in Crassostrea gigas juveniles in France and to reduce its impact on oyster production. As part of this program, four successive generations of families were bred between 2001 and 2005 in our research hatchery in La Tremblade. Survival and growth were recorded in the field in three sites along the French coast (Ronce, Rivière d'Auray and Baie des Veys). The first generation (44 full-sib families nested within 17 half-sib families) was tested during summer 2001 to assess to what extent genetic variability exists for spat survival. An important genetic basis was found (estimated narrow-sense heritability among sites = 0.83 ± 0.40). In contrast, lower...

Resistance to Chalkbrood Disease in Apis mellifera L. (Hymenoptera: Apidae) Colonies with Different Hygienic Behaviour Neotropical Entomology
Invernizzi,C; Rivas,F; Bettucci,L.
Chalkbrood disease affects the larvae of honeybees Apis mellifera L. and is caused by the fungus Ascosphaera apis. Infected larvae die when they are stretched in the cap cell and suffer a gradual hardening that ends in a very hard structure (mummie). Several studies have demonstrated that colonies that express an efficient hygienic behaviour (uncapping of cell and subsequent removal of dead brood) exhibit a higher resistance to the disease. However, it remains unclear whether the advantage of hygienic colonies over less hygienic ones lies in the ability to remove mummies or in the early detection of infected larvae and its cannibalization before they harden. To elucidate this aspect, the hygienic behaviour of 24 colonies, which were subsequently provided...
